General Specification of AMD Radeon RX 640

AMD Radeon RX 640 released with GDDR5 and 4 GB on 12 August 2019 (4 years old). VRAM (GPU memory) is important for graphic card performance since it allows a graphics card to hold high-resolution frames, more complex textures, and other content. More GPU RAM does not always result in faster FPS, but it does provide a smoother, more consistent experience, particularly at high graphics settings.

Radeon RX 640 has 112.0 GB/s data transfer speed and memory operates at the response speed 6000 MHz.

Furthermore, Radeon RX 640 has core clock speed of 1218 MHz and dissipate heat 50 Watt.
